The Dare

The dark green bottle swung round, round and round. I was hoping it wouldn’t land on me but somehow I knew it would it’s my luck I never ever have good look. I closed my eyes.
“Joanne it’s landed on you!” Rachel told me. I knew it, no matter how much I wished, it had landed on me.
“I dare you to light a firework in your garden.” Said Rachel. I knew this was dangerous but could I really look like a wimp in front of all of these cool people? No. I had to do it.
“All right then.” I replied trying to look brave. I didn’t want to do this, but I had to, I had finally become mates with some of the cool older people and I knew I couldn’t look like a wimp in front of them.
I stood up slowly, I was shaking – a bag of nerves. What would my mom say? What about my dad? If they knew I’d be in deep trouble, but they won’t find out what harm will a little rocket do? I walked down the stairs breaking out in a cold sweat. Gulping with each step I took. I wanted the floor to swallow me up there was no way I could get out of this. It’ll be so dangerous but I can’t say no now.
I walked towards the garden shed where our fireworks were kept for bonfire night. I had no idea which was which let alone fully set one off for a dare. I grabbed a big red one. It was shaped like a rocket so I assumed it was one. Everything seemed fine, it wasn’t damp and the firework wasn’t damaged.
“Come on Joanne! Hurry up with that firework!” Shouted Jason, they were egging me on now Chanting “Jo-anne, Jo-anne!” constantly in a familier tune. I made sure the ground wasn’t wet and pushed the end of the stick on the firework into the ground with a bit of force.
I took out a match and struck the match box with a lot of force. I seemed to take my anger – fuelled by my stupidity, out on the match box. The match didn’t light. I took out another match and struck the match box again. The match finally caught fire, the flame a bright yellow colour burning brightly.
“Get on with it Joanne!” Complained Jason again. I put the lit match to the end of the firework by the stick. I watched it catch alight, taking a step back I realised how stupid I was. The firework let out an ear screeching scream. Nothing was happening apart from the weird sound. What had happened?
I took a step forwards to check the firework. Suddenly, it let off some sparks. Brightly coloured blasts of light shot up, I tried to dodge them but I couldn’t. One of them sank into my arm I immediately felt the heat of it burning my skin, the hairs on my arm being singed.
I let out a huge yelp of pain.
“Woah! Joanne move the hell out of the way!” Screamed Rachel in horror. I dived onto the patio scratching my leg but I knew that I would rather have a little scratch than anymore firework burns. It felt like my arm was on fire and I couldn’t do anything about it. Jason & Rachel & everyone else ran over to me. They asked if I was alright. I didn’t reply. I was so angry at myself for doing what they said. They weren’t cool, they just forced people to do stuff for the sake of them having fun.
I told them I was fine, and told them to go home. I didn’t want them here with me. I stunk like an ashtray and had a gigantic, Bulging blister on my arm from where the spark had landed. As soon as they were gone I ran up to the bath room and put an ice cold cloth on my blister. It was horrid but the coldness of the cloth calmed it down. It was so soothing like a gust of wind on a hot and muggy day. I ran downstairs into the garden and picked up the firework. It was still hot and had smoke coming from it but I had to get rid of it so I picked it up and put it in the bin. I now know that I was stupid, I shouldn’t have listened to them and accepted that dare, because I did I have a scar on my arm that will never ever go away.
